본문 바로가기
투자전략

주식 초보도 퀀트 고수로 만들어주는 주식 백테스팅 툴 퀀터스

by investor2020 2023. 5. 20.

퀀터스는 별도의 프로그램 설치 없이 쉽고 빠르게 주식 퀀트 전략을 만들고 백테스트 해볼 수 있는 종합 백테스팅 툴입니다. 퀀트 초보가 사용하기에도 매우 쉽고 직관적인 유저 인터페이스를 가지고 있습니다. 출시 후 여러 기능들이 추가되고 업그레이드가 되었고 앞으로도 많은 기능이 추가될 예정이라고 합니다. 기본적인 기능은 무료로 사용이 가능하고 현재는 부분 유료화가 되었습니다.

퀀터스-썸네일

목차
1. 퀀터스 무료 사용 방법
2. 퀀터스 백테스트 방법
3. 실제 백테스트 결과
4. 유료 이용 방법 안내
5. 요약

 

 

 

퀀터스 무료 사용 방법

퀀터스는 자신의 퀀트 수준에 맞게 초급, 중급, 고급 레벨을 선택할 수 있습니다. 레벨이 올라갈수록 선택할 수 있는 퀀트 팩터가 많아지고 팩터를 커스텀하여 새로운 팩터를 만들 수도 있습니다. 부분 유료화로 인해 현재는 초급 레벨만 무료입니다. 초급 레벨에서는 커스텀 필터/팩터/자산배분/10 분위테스트/과거거래내역보기 기능을 제외한 모든 기능은 “무료”로 이용 가능하며, 그 외 중/고급 모드 및 위 언급드린 고급 기능들은 '유료'로 사용권을 구매하셔야 이용이 가능합니다.

 

퀀터스 백테스트 방법

유니버스 선택

현재 한국과 미국 주식 백테스트가 가능하며 코스피나 코스닥으로 한정해서 백테스트도 가능합니다.

기본 필터

퀀트 수익률에 악영향을 미치는 관리 종목, 적자 기업 등을 제외할 수 있는 필터입니다. 기존에 커스텀 필터로 입력해야 했던 소형주 시가 총액 하위 20% 필터가 새로 생겼습니다. 한국 주식은 하위 20% 소형주에서 퀀트 전략이 잘 통하기 때문에 소형주 필터도 체크해야 합니다.

기본 필터 선택 화면

미국 주식은 한국 주식과 달리 소형주들도 시가총액이 크고 종목이 많아서 소형주 하위 10%로도 실전에서 퀀트 투자가 가능합니다. 따라서 커스텀 필터에서 시가총액 필터를 하위 10% 설정하는 것이 수익률 개선에 더 도움이 됩니다.

커스텀-필터에서-시가총액을-하위-10%로-설정하는-모습
커스텀 필터를 통해 시가 총액 비율을 자유롭게 조정할 수 있다

 

필터 순위 지정

소형주 하위 20%를 먼저 추리고 나중에 기본필터(관리 종목, 적자 기업 등)를 제외할지 먼저 기본필터를 적용 후에 남은 종목에서 하위 20%를 추릴지 적용 순위를 결정하는 항목입니다. 기본 설정은 시가총액 하위 20%를 제일 마지막에 적용하도록 되어있습니다.

 

팩터 선택

팩터는 크게 가치 팩터, 퀄리티 팩터, 가격 팩터, 성장성 팩터, 가속 팩터 이렇게 5가지가 있습니다. 적게는 2개에서 많게는 10개 이상의 팩터를 조합하여 다양한 전략을 백테스팅 해볼 수 있습니다. 무료 버전인 초급 레벨에서는 가치 팩터, 퀄리티 팩터, 성장성 팩터만 사용 가능 합니다.

 

 

초급 레벨 선택 가능 팩터(무료 버전)

가치 팩터

PER, PBR, PSR, POR, PRR, PGPR, NCAV

 

퀄리티 팩터

ROE, ROA, GP/A, Asset Turnover, F-score

 

성장성 팩터

순이익성장률 (QoQ), 순이익성장률 (YoY), 영업이익성장률 (QoQ), 영업이익성장률 (YoY), 매출총이익성장률 (QoQ), 매출총이익성장률 (YoY), 매출액성장률 (QoQ), 매출액성장률 (YoY)

 

저는 현재 신마법 공식과 성장주 전략에 투자 중인데 이 두 가지 전략은 무료 버전에서도 백테스트가 가능합니다. 

 

고급 레벨 선택 가능 팩터(유료 버전)

중급 및 고급 레벨에서는 초급 레벨보다 훨씬 더 많은 팩터를 제공합니다. 중/고급 레벨과 자산 배분 등의 고급 기능들은 유료 사용권을 구매하셔야 이용이 가능합니다.

가치 팩터(price 관련)

시가총액, PER, PBR, PSR, POR, PCR, PFCR, PRR, PGPR, PEG, PAR, PACR, NCAV, 배당수익률, 주주수익률

 

가치 팩터 (EV 관련)

EV, EV/Net, EV/Sales, EV/EBITDA, EV/EBIT, EV/GP, EV/R&D, EV/CF, EV/AC

 

퀄리티 팩터

ROE, ROA, GP/E, GP/A, Asset Turnover, GPM, OPM, NPM, F-score, R&D / 매출액, R&D / 매출총이익, R&D / 영업이익, R&D / 순이익, AC/A, AC/E, 변동성 (52주), 변동성 (60일), 영업이익 / 차입금, 차입금비율

 

가격 팩터

1개월 모멘텀, 3개월 모멘텀, 6개월 모멘텀, 12개월 모멘텀, 종가 (수정 전), 샤프비율, 샤프비율 모멘텀 (20일), 샤프비율 모멘텀 (60일), 샤프비율 모멘텀 (120일), 샤프비율 모멘텀 (200일), 베타, 베타 (60일), 절댓값 베타, 절댓값 베타 (60일), 개인순매수강도, 기관순매수강도, 외인순매수강도, 기관/외인순매수강도, 거래대금 회전율

 

성장성 팩터

순이익성장률 (QoQ), 순이익성장률 (YoY), 영업이익성장률 (QoQ), 영업이익성장률 (YoY), 매출총이익성장률 (QoQ), 매출총이익성장률 (YoY), 매출액성장률 (QoQ), 매출액성장률 (YoY), 자산성장률 (QoQ), 자산성장률 (YoY), 자본성장률 (QoQ), 자본성장률 (YoY), GP/A성장률 (QoQ), GP/A성장률 (YoY), 영업이익 / 차입금 성장 (YoY), 영업이익 / 차입금 성장 (QoQ), 현금흐름 성장 (QoQ), 현금흐름 성장 (YoY), 연구개발비 지출 성장 (QoQ), 연구개발비 지출 성장 (YoY), 보유 현금성자산 성장 (QoQ), 보유 현금성자산 성장 (YoY), 차입금 성장 (QoQ), 차입금 성장 (YoY)

 

가속 팩터

이동평균 모멘텀 가속 (3/3/10), 이동평균 모멘텀 가속 (3/12/5), 이동평균 모멘텀 가속 (10/1/5), 순이익성장 가속 (YoY), 순이익성장 가속 (QoQ), 매출액성장 가속 (YoY), 매출액성장 가속 (QoQ), 매출총이익 성장 가속 (YoY), 매출총이익 성장 가속 (QoQ), 영업이익 성장 가속 (YoY), 영업이익 성장 가속 (QoQ)

 

커스텀 팩터

시가총액, 재고자산, 무형자산, 자산총계, 자본총계, 매출액, 매출총이익, 영업이익, 순이익, 부채총계, 광고선전비, 연구개발비, 인건비 및 복리후생비

연구개발비/시가총액, 광고선전비/시가총액 등 나만의 지표를 커스텀해서 백테스트도 가능합니다.

 

백테스트 설정

초기 투자 금액은 보통 1~2천만 원으로 입력하고 거래 수수료는 슬리피지를 고려하여 0.5~1%를 입력합니다. 소형주 전략도 소액에서는 슬리피지가 생각보다 크지 않기 때문에 0.5%를 입력하셔도 되고 보수적으로 테스트하고 싶으신 경우 1%를 입력하시면 됩니다.

 

 

 

 리밸런싱 설정

퀀트 전략은 포트폴리오를 10~20 종목으로 구성하는 경우가 가장 많습니다. 퀀트 전략들은 보통 월별이나 분기 리밸런싱을 많이 하는 편입니다.

 

환율 반영 옵션

미국 주식의 경우 환율 반영 여부를 설정할 수 있습니다. 이 기능 덕분에 원화 투자자의 경우 과거 각 시점별로 원화 기준 보유 자산을 더 정확하게  파악할 수 있습니다.

 

손/익절 설정

현재는 한국 주식에서만 손절, 익절 기능을 지원하고 있습니다. 손절은 0~70까지 익절은 0~10000까지 입력할 수 있습니다. 손절이나 익절을 설정한 뒤 백테스트를 몇 번 해봤는데 연 복리 수익률(CAGR)은 크게 감소하고 MDD(최대 손실)는 비슷하거나 약간 감소하는 결과가 나왔습니다. 강환국 님 유튜브에 손익절 백테스트 영상에서도 보면 역시 손절 익절이 수익률 개선에 크게 도움이 되지는 않는 것 같습니다.

손절과-익절의-기준을-설정하는-화면
손절 익절 설정 화면

 

실제 백테스트 결과

성장주와 가치주 그리고 둘을 결합한 성장가치주 전략을 백테스트 해보겠습니다.

한국주식, 시가 총액 하위 20% 소형주, 거래 수수료 1%, 분기별 리밸런싱, 20 종목

백테스트 구간 - 2003.1.1 ~ 2023. 5. 19

 

 

가치주

PER, POR, PGPR, PSR

4대-가치-지표를-활용한-백테스트-결과
연복리 수익률 37.38% MDD -61.52%

성장주

순이익성장률 (QoQ), 순이익성장률 (YoY), 영업이익성장률 (QoQ), 영업이익성장률 (YoY), 매출총이익성장률 (QoQ), 매출총이익성장률 (YoY), 매출액성장률 (QoQ), 매출액성장률 (YoY)

성장-지표를-활용한-백테스트-결과
연복리 수익률 44.56% MDD -58.70%

성장가치주

가치팩터 + 성장팩터

4대-가치-지표와-성장-지표를-결합한-백테스트-결과
연복리 수익률 45.02% MDD -59.69%

자산 배분 기능

자산 배분은 퀀터스의 가장 매력적인 기능 중 하나입니다. 퀀터스 자산배분의 가장 큰 장점은 팩터 포트폴리오와의 혼합 백테스트가 가능하다는 것입니다. 주식 이외에 금이나 채권 현금 등을 조합하여 포트폴리오 백테스트가 가능합니다.

예를 들어, 한국 퀀트 전략 + 미국 퀀트 전략 + 금 + 채권 등으로 포트폴리오를 구성해 백테스트 할 수도 있습니다.

자산-배분-설정-화면-퀀트-전략과-자산군을-결합하여-백테스트-가능
퀀트 전략과 채권, 금을 조합하여 백테스트가 가능

 

유료 사용권 가격

유료 사용권은 다양한 옵션으로 제공되고 있습니다. 회원 가입 후 퀀터스 홈페이지를 참고하세요.

 

추천인 코드

  • ‘사용권 구매’ 페이지에서 사용권 ‘구매하기’ 클릭 후 ‘추천인 코드'를 입력할 수 있습니다.
  • 추천인 코드에 omega3 입력해주세요.
  • 추천인 코드를 입력 후 구독권 3개월권을 구입 시, 기간 1주일 연장
  • 추천인 코드를 입력 후 구독권 1년권을 구입 시, 기간 1개월 연장

퀀터스-이용권-구매-시-추천인-코드-입력-화면
이용권 구매시 추천인 코드 입력

요약

  • 퀀터스는 설치 없이 웹페이지 기반으로 빠르게 퀀트 전략을 백테스트할 수 있는 툴입니다.
  • 기본 기능은 무료로 사용이 가능하며 유료 구매 시 더 다양한 기능들을 사용할 수 있습니다.
  • 한국 주식, 미국 주식(환율 반영), 자산 배분까지 가능한 종합 선물세트입니다.
  • 추후 자동매매도 지원할 예정입니다.

 

reference)

https://quantus.kr/universe

https://youtu.be/B4y99dsf834

https://youtu.be/cYtyciJuhkQ

댓글